Digital Trading Revolution: How Tech is Changing Stock Sales Forever

The way we buy and sell stocks has undergone a seismic shift. Gone are the days of frantic phone calls to brokers and paper stock certificates—today, investors can sell shares online in seconds with just a few taps on their smartphones.

This digital trading revolution is reshaping investing, making markets more accessible, efficient, and fast-paced than ever before. But what exactly is driving this transformation? How can investors leverage these changes to trade smarter?

The Rise of Online Trading: From Broker Calls to Instant Trades

Just two decades ago, selling stocks required:

  • Calling a broker during market hours
  • Paying hefty commissions per trade
  • Waiting hours (or days) for execution

Today, platforms like Robinhood, eToro, and Interactive Brokers allow anyone to sell shares online instantly—often with zero-commission fees.

Key Milestones in Digital Trading:

📌 1990s: Online brokerages like E*TRADE emerge, reducing reliance on human brokers.
📌 2008: Mobile trading apps debut, enabling trades from anywhere.
📌 2013: Robinhood launches commission-free trading, forcing industry-wide fee cuts.
📌 2020s: AI-driven tools, fractional shares, and 24/7 crypto trading redefine accessibility.

How Technology is Transforming Stock Sales

1. AI & Algorithmic Trading

  • Robo-advisors (e.g., Betterment, Wealthfront) automatically rebalance portfolios.
  • Predictive analytics help time the market using historical data.
  • Sentiment analysis scans news/social media to gauge stock momentum.

2. Fractional Shares & Micro-Investing

  • Investors can now sell shares in small portions (e.g., $1 of Amazon stock).
  • Apps like Public and SoFi make markets accessible with minimal capital.

3. Blockchain & Tokenized Assets

  • Some platforms allow trading tokenized stocks (e.g., Tesla as a crypto asset).
  • Settlements happen faster via blockchain vs. traditional clearinghouses.

4. Social Trading & Copy Portfolios

  • Platforms like eToro let users mimic trades of top investors.
  • Reddit’s WallStreetBets has moved markets (e.g., GameStop saga).

5. Extended & 24/7 Trading

  • Pre-market (4 AM–9:30 AM ET) and after-hours (4 PM–8 PM ET) sessions let investors sell shares online outside standard hours.
  • Crypto markets never close—hinting at a future where stock trading could be 24/7.

The Pros and Cons of Selling Shares Online

✅ Advantages

✔ Speed: Execute trades in milliseconds.
✔ Lower Costs: Most brokers now charge $0 commissions.
✔ Control: Set custom orders (limit, stop-loss, trailing stops).
✔ Accessibility: Trade from anywhere via mobile apps.
✔ Data-Driven Decisions: Real-time charts, news alerts, and AI insights.

❌ Risks & Challenges

  • Overtrading: Easy access can lead to impulsive decisions.
  • Technical Glitches: App crashes during volatile periods (e.g., Robinhood’s 2021 outage).
  • Security Threats: Phishing, hacking risks for online accounts.
  • Lack of Human Guidance: Beginners may struggle without a broker’s advice.

How to Sell Shares Online Like a Pro

1. Choose the Right Platform

Compare brokers by:

  • Fees (commission, withdrawal, inactivity charges)
  • Execution speed
  • Research tools (earnings calendars, analyst ratings)
  • User experience (mobile app ratings)

Top Picks:

  • Active Traders: Interactive Brokers, TD Ameritrade
  • Beginners: Fidelity, Charles Schwab
  • Social/Copy Trading: eToro, Public

2. Master Order Types

  • Market Order: Sell immediately at current price (risky in volatility).
  • Limit Order: Set a minimum sale price (e.g., “Don’t sell below $50”).
  • Stop-Loss Order: Automatically sells if stock hits a certain downside.
  • Trailing Stop: Locks in profits while allowing upside.

3. Time Your Trades Wisely

  • Avoid trading at market open/close (high volatility).
  • Watch for earnings reports, Fed announcements, or economic data releases.

4. Tax Optimization

  • Hold stocks >1 year for lower capital gains tax.
  • Offset gains with losses (tax-loss harvesting).
